ASCB 2009 Poster - Angiongenesis and Cell Invasion
We demonstrate a microfluidic based method to follow angiogenesis or cell invasion in real time. The method enables acquisition of high content data by microscopy using microfluidic flow cells which are optimized for imaging.

Differentiation of Rat Mesenchymal Stem Cells Under Shear Stress
Stem cell research has the potential to produce novel treatments for previously incurable diseases and injuries. For studies of stem cell differentiation, scientists have traditionally used biochemical stimulation. However, shear stress can also be used. Here we demonstrate the differentiation of rat mesenchymal stem cells into von Willebrand factor (vWF)-expressing endothelial cells as a result of shear stress.
